Each EmpowerSTEM session lasts approximately two hours. The experience begins with a brief introduction to the day’s challenge, followed by a 10-minute mini-lesson covering the core engineering concepts relevant to the activity. Participants are then divided into small groups of 2–4 to collaboratively build their project.
As students work, facilitators guide them through the engineering design process—constructing, testing, optimizing, and iterating. Toward the end of the session, each group presents their final design and tests their project in front of their peers. To conclude, participants complete a reflection sheet to capture what they learned, how they approached the challenge, and how the experience shaped their understanding of engineering.
